
When considering the distance from Brazil to London, it’s important to note that Brazil is a vast country in South America, while London is a city in the United Kingdom, located in Europe. The exact distance varies depending on the specific starting point in Brazil, as the country spans over 2,700 miles from north to south. For example, the flight distance from São Paulo, Brazil, to London is approximately 5,850 miles (9,415 kilometers), while from Rio de Janeiro, it’s around 5,700 miles (9,173 kilometers). These distances are typically measured as the crow flies (straight-line distance) and can differ slightly based on the flight path taken by airlines, which may account for factors like wind patterns and air traffic routes.

Direct Distance Calculation: Shortest path between Brazil and London via great circle route
The shortest distance between two points on Earth’s surface is not a straight line but a curve known as a great circle route. This principle is crucial when calculating the direct distance between Brazil and London, as it accounts for the planet’s spherical shape. By following this path, we minimize travel distance, a concept essential for aviation, maritime navigation, and even long-distance planning. For instance, a flight from São Paulo to London would traverse this route, reducing fuel consumption and travel time compared to less efficient paths.
To calculate this distance, start by identifying the coordinates of key cities in Brazil (e.g., Brasília at 15.79° S, 47.88° W) and London (51.51° N, 0.13° W). Use the Haversine formula, a standard method for great circle distance calculations, which incorporates latitude and longitude differences. The formula is: *a = sin²(Δlat/2) + cos(lat1) × cos(lat2) × sin²(Δlong/2)*, where *c = 2 × atan2(√a, √(1−a))*, and distance = *c × Earth’s radius*. Earth’s radius is approximately 3,959 miles. Applying this to Brasília and London yields a distance of roughly 5,600 miles, though the exact figure varies based on the specific Brazilian city chosen.
While the Haversine formula is precise, online tools like Google Maps or specialized distance calculators simplify the process. These tools automatically account for great circle routes and provide instant results. However, understanding the underlying mathematics ensures accuracy, especially when dealing with less common locations or specific travel needs. For example, a sailor plotting a transatlantic course might prefer manual calculations to verify digital outputs.
Practical applications of this calculation extend beyond curiosity. Airlines optimize fuel efficiency by adhering to great circle routes, and travelers can estimate flight durations more accurately. For instance, a 5,600-mile journey at an average commercial flight speed of 560 mph translates to about 10 hours of travel time. This knowledge empowers individuals to plan trips, understand flight paths, and appreciate the geometry of global navigation. Flight Distance vs. Straight Line: Difference between flight paths and direct distance measurements
The distance from Brazil to London is a question that invites a straightforward answer, but the reality is more nuanced. When you ask for the distance between two points on a globe, you’re typically met with two distinct measurements: the straight-line distance (also known as the "as the crow flies" distance) and the flight distance. Understanding the difference between these two is crucial, especially for travelers and planners. The straight-line distance from São Paulo, Brazil, to London, UK, is approximately 5,840 miles. However, commercial flights rarely follow this direct path due to factors like wind patterns, airspace restrictions, and fuel efficiency.
Consider the flight path of a typical commercial airliner traveling this route. Instead of a straight line across the Atlantic, the plane might arc northward to take advantage of favorable jet streams, which can significantly reduce travel time and fuel consumption. For instance, a common flight path might cover around 6,200 miles, adding roughly 360 miles to the journey. This detour isn’t arbitrary—it’s a calculated decision based on real-time weather data and air traffic control directives. Travelers should note that while the straight-line distance provides a theoretical minimum, the actual flight distance is what determines fuel costs, carbon emissions, and arrival times.
To illustrate the practical implications, let’s break down the numbers. A Boeing 777, a common aircraft for long-haul flights, consumes approximately 5 miles per gallon of jet fuel. On a 5,840-mile straight-line route, it would theoretically require 1,168 gallons of fuel. However, the actual 6,200-mile flight path increases fuel consumption to 1,240 gallons—a difference of 72 gallons. At an average jet fuel price of $2.50 per gallon, this detour adds $180 to the fuel cost for the airline. Multiply this by hundreds of flights annually, and the economic and environmental impact becomes clear.
For those planning travel, understanding this difference can help set realistic expectations. A straight-line distance might suggest a shorter journey, but the flight distance is what airlines and flight-tracking apps will reflect. Additionally, frequent flyers can use this knowledge to advocate for more sustainable practices, such as supporting airlines that optimize routes for fuel efficiency. Tools like flight simulators or aviation apps can visually demonstrate these paths, offering a deeper appreciation for the complexities of air travel.

Travel Time by Air: Estimated hours flying from major Brazilian cities to London
The distance between Brazil and London varies significantly depending on the departure city, but the average flight time from major Brazilian hubs to London typically ranges from 10 to 12 hours. This estimate assumes non-stop flights, which are the most efficient way to travel this route. For instance, a direct flight from São Paulo (GRU) to London Heathrow (LHR) covers approximately 5,900 miles and takes around 11 hours and 30 minutes. Understanding these specifics helps travelers plan their journeys more effectively, especially when considering time zones, layovers, and jet lag.
For travelers departing from Rio de Janeiro (GIG), the flight time to London is slightly longer, averaging around 11 hours and 45 minutes for a non-stop journey. This route spans roughly 5,700 miles, and while the difference in distance from São Paulo is minimal, factors like wind patterns and flight paths can influence travel time. Those flying from Brasília (BSB) should expect a slightly longer duration, as direct flights are less common, often requiring a stopover in São Paulo or Rio, adding 2–3 hours to the total travel time.
When planning a trip from the northeastern city of Recife (REC), travelers face a more substantial journey. Direct flights are rare, and most itineraries include a layover, extending the total travel time to 14–16 hours. This contrasts with flights from Porto Alegre (POA) in the south, which, despite being farther from London in terms of Brazilian geography, benefit from more direct routes, averaging 12 hours. These variations highlight the importance of checking flight specifics, as regional differences within Brazil can significantly impact travel logistics.

Popular Routes: Common flight paths from Brazil to London and their distances
The most direct route from Brazil to London typically spans over 5,000 miles, with flights originating from São Paulo or Rio de Janeiro. These routes often follow a northeasterly trajectory across the Atlantic Ocean, minimizing travel time to approximately 11 to 12 hours. Airlines like British Airways and LATAM frequently operate this path, leveraging the Earth’s curvature to optimize fuel efficiency and speed. While this is the shortest distance, factors like wind patterns and air traffic can slightly alter the actual flight path.
For travelers departing from Brazil’s northeastern cities, such as Recife or Fortaleza, the distance to London increases to around 5,500 miles. Flights from these locations tend to arc further east before turning north, adding roughly 30 to 60 minutes to the journey. This route is less common but can be advantageous during certain seasons due to favorable tailwinds. Travelers should consider this option if they’re already in the northeast or if ticket prices are more competitive.
A less conventional but increasingly popular route involves a stopover in the Caribbean or North America. For instance, flights from Brazil to London via Miami or Lisbon extend the total distance to over 6,000 miles but offer flexibility for those seeking to break up the journey. This option is particularly appealing for passengers who prefer avoiding long stretches in the air or wish to explore an additional destination en route. However, it adds 4 to 6 hours to the total travel time, making it a trade-off between convenience and duration.
